The annual Kick-Off to Summer Safety event sponsored by the Hopkins Police and Fire Departments in partnership with Hopkins/Minnetonka Park & Recreation and Minnesota Safe Kids Coalition will be held Saturday, May 19, from 10 a .m. to 1 p.m., at the Hopkins Fire Station, 101 17th Avenue S.
This free, family-friendly event will feature water, bike, fire and internet safety tips, ice cream and prize giveaways, including bikes, locks, helmets, life jackets, car seats and more. Residents can also make an appointment to have child seats installed and inspected. Call 952-548-6407 to reserve a time slot.
